I have 2 lbs of wool and I have so many ideas for so many things, if only I have as much time as ideas. I kool-aide dyed this wool. Very simple too; I boiled some water and added the wool to season the wool then added the kool- aide and let it sit in the water while I stirred. The water magically turned clear and it was done.
